The Origins of Horror
On your own in the dead of night was one of the very first video clip video games to blend 3D polygonal figures with pre-rendered backgrounds, developing an immersive cinematic experience previously unseen in gaming. Set inside the nineteen twenties, players could decide on to regulate both Edward Carnby, A non-public investigator, or Emily Hartwood, the niece of a man who died beneath mysterious situation. Their target: look into the haunted Derceto Mansion.

What designed the sport groundbreaking was its environment. The mansion felt alive with malevolent presence—doors creaked, monsters lurked within the shadows, and music constructed tension with every step. The limited digicam angles, fastened Views, and tank-like controls additional towards the sense of helplessness, immersing gamers in the planet of dread.

Pioneering Gameplay Mechanics
Beyond the horror aesthetic, By itself in the dead of night pioneered gameplay aspects that became staples in survival horror:

Limited Means: Ammunition and wellbeing things were scarce, forcing gamers to Feel strategically as opposed to rely on brute pressure.

Puzzle Solving: Much of the game involved deciphering cryptic clues, accumulating products, and resolving environmental puzzles, fostering a slow, methodical solution.

Evolution and Legacy
The initial game's accomplishment spawned several sequels all through the nineteen nineties and early 2000s. Whilst later on titles launched modern controls, up to date graphics, and diverse narratives, they struggled to seize the magic of the first. A 2008 reboot attempted to revitalize the franchise with a more action-oriented technique, but it really received mixed testimonials as a consequence of technical concerns and an inconsistent tone.

In 2023, On your own in the dead of night returned which has a highly anticipated reboot by Pieces Interactive and THQ Nordic. This modern day iteration aimed to recapture the initial’s eerie tone although updating the gameplay for recent-era platforms. With improved graphics, refined storytelling, and robust voice acting, the reboot reintroduced Edward Carnby and Emily Hartwood to a fresh generation of gamers while honoring the legacy from the franchise.
